Virtual plenary meeting of the International Civil Aviation Organisation’s Environment Committee

Written by: Thomas Rötger Every three years in February, the UN International Civil Aviation Organisation (ICAO) holds the plenary meeting of its Committee for Aviation Environmental Protection (CAEP). Normally, this meeting gathers about 200 aviation experts representing the States and international organisations at the ICAO Headquarters for two weeks in snowy Montréal. Not surprisingly, the […]
